Line 133: "If all series and data point edge-rounding values are 5%, then the
check box Rounded Edges will be displayed as on."

I have created a file with 'd3d:edge-rounding="4.5%"' and the check-box is
checked after loading. The boundary value seems to be not exact 5%. In a file
with 'd3d:edge-rounding="4.4%"' the check-box was unchecked.

My suggestion: "If all series and data point edge-rounding values are rounded
off 5%, then the check box Rounded Edges will be displayed as on." This has to
be done for all other sentences, too.
